Little Jim's Tavern

3501 North Halsted Street, Chicago, IL 60657

Bars & Taverns

This bar started it all when it was the first gay bar to open in the Northalsted area (formerly known as Boystown). Little Jim's is big with the late night crowd and features daily drink specials.
